diff options
Diffstat (limited to 'java/common/build.xml')
| -rw-r--r-- | java/common/build.xml | 20 |
1 files changed, 8 insertions, 12 deletions
diff --git a/java/common/build.xml b/java/common/build.xml index 6172a680ec..dfe060cdef 100644 --- a/java/common/build.xml +++ b/java/common/build.xml @@ -28,7 +28,6 @@ <property name="xml.spec.dir" location="${project.root}/../specs" /> <property name="xml.spec.deps" value="amqp.0-8.xml amqp.0-9.xml" /> <property name="xml.spec.list" value="${xml.spec.dir}/amqp.0-8.xml ${xml.spec.dir}/amqp.0-9.xml" /> - <property name="mllib.dir" value="${project.root}/../python" /> <property name="gentools.timestamp" location="${generated.dir}/gentools.timestamp" /> <property name="jython.timestamp" location="${generated.dir}/jython.timestamp" /> @@ -39,17 +38,14 @@ </target> <target name="jython" depends="check_jython_deps" unless="jython.notRequired"> - <java classname="org.python.util.jython" fork="true" failonerror="true"> - <arg value="-Dpython.cachedir.skip=true"/> - <arg value="-Dpython.path=${basedir}/jython-lib.jar/Lib${path.separator}${mllib.dir}"/> - <arg value="${basedir}/codegen"/> - <arg value="${module.precompiled}"/> - <arg value="${xml.spec.dir}/amqp.0-10-qpid-errata.xml"/> - <arg value="${basedir}"/> - <classpath> - <pathelement location="jython-2.2-rc2.jar"/> - </classpath> - </java> + <jython path="${mllib.dir}"> + <args> + <arg value="${basedir}/codegen"/> + <arg value="${module.precompiled}"/> + <arg value="${xml.spec.dir}/amqp.0-10-qpid-errata.xml"/> + <arg value="${basedir}"/> + </args> + </jython> <touch file="${jython.timestamp}" /> </target> |
